javascript - 如何安排在perl中每小时执行一次脚本的一部分,而其余脚本每分钟刷新一次

标签 javascript perl

我有一个每分钟刷新网页的 Perl 脚本。现在我想添加一些应该每小时一次的 MySQL 查询。 Perl 中是否有像 JavaScript 中那样的计划执行器,或者我可以将 JavaScript 合并到 Perl 中吗?

最佳答案

此解决方案使用 Perl

您可以在 perl 中使用 localtime() 函数。 计算一个小时的差异并发出 MySQL 查询。

要了解localtime(),请访问this链接。

您可以使用 CPAN 的 Time::HiRes

请阅读Time::HiRes here .

遵循这段代码:

use Time::Elapse;

## somewhere in your code...
Time::Elapse->lapse(my $now);

#...rest of code execution    
print "Time Elapsed: $now\n";

关于javascript - 如何安排在perl中每小时执行一次脚本的一部分,而其余脚本每分钟刷新一次,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15265860/

相关文章:

javascript - Angular - 加载 View 而不更改 url

javascript - 使用 jquery 在 asp.net 中自动完成

javascript - 为什么 DOMappendChild() 在 ('load' ,...) 上触发,但 jQueryappend() 不会?

javascript - 被拖拽的物体逃跑

javascript - 在 light DOM 中渲染 lit-element 以与 stripe.js 一起使用

javascript - 运行脚本后如何返回成功

perl - 使用 perl 应用补丁文件?

multithreading - 在 Perl 中,如何使用多个线程来处理大型数组的一部分?

perl - MariaDB 复制有时不起作用

正则表达式自动增量替换